This opportunity is issued by the Department of National Defence (DND), Royal Canadian Air Force (RCAF), for the procurement of ruggedized wearable GPS tracking devices and tactical replacement straps for Search and Rescue Technicians (SARTech):
Government Buyer:
- Department of National Defence (DND), Royal Canadian Air Force (RCAF)
- Directorate Aerospace Procurement, DGAEPM/DAP/DAP 2-2-7
- Contracting Authority: Kyle Sorrie
Products/Quantities Requested:
- 240 high-performance, ruggedized wearable GPS tracking devices
- Must be commercial off-the-shelf (COTS)
- Key technical requirements:
- Minimum 100 hours continuous GPS tracking battery life (or 260 hours with solar assist)
- Dynamic navigation with preloaded topographic maps
- Offline route generation (no cellular coverage required)
- Physical button redundancy for all navigation functions
- Integrated micro-LED task light
- 240 secondary tactical replacement straps
- 26mm wide, durable silicone elastomer
- Resistant to aviation fluids and chemicals
- Must be in approved tactical colors (black, olive drab, or dark brown)
Delivery:
- All items to be delivered to the 25 Canadian Forces Supply Depot
- Delivery terms: FCA (Free Carrier) at contractor's facility
Unique/Notable Requirements:
- Devices must be suitable for harsh operational environments
- Straps must comply with strict durability and color standards
- No specific OEMs or part numbers are named; open to any compliant COTS solution
- Selection will be based on lowest price through open competitive bidding
No services are requested in this solicitation.
Description
The Department of National Defence (DND) of Canada has an immediate operational requirement to procure 240 commercial off-the-shelf high-performance, ruggedized wearable GPS tracking devices along with 240 secondary tactical replacement straps. The delivery location is the 25 Canadian Forces Supply Depot. The contract duration is estimated to be 7 months, starting approximately on August 17, 2026. The procurement will be conducted through a competitive open bidding process with selection based on the lowest price.
